From 21 May to 21 September, the green boulevards of Amsterdam Zuid will transform into an open-air museum during the ninth edition of the Amsterdam Sculpture Biennale ARTZUID 2025. This year’s theme, Enlightenment, celebrates Amsterdam’s 750th anniversary and its spirit of freedom, tolerance and innovation.

Curated by renowned art historian Ralph Keuning, the exhibition features more than 60 striking sculptures and installations by internationally acclaimed artists such as Alicja Kwade, Leiko Ikemura, Tschabalala Self, Neo Rauch, and Atelier van Lieshout. The artworks span from abstract and architectural to figurative and thought-provoking, inviting visitors to reflect on the human condition, history and our collective future.

Set along the iconic Apollolaan, Minervalaan and Zuidas, ARTZUID is free to visit and offers a unique cultural experience for locals, tourists, and especially expats seeking to connect with the creative heart of the city.
